kendo grid columns set attributes dynamically

kendo grid columns set attributes dynamically

Could you please provide an example using remote data? privacy statement. I have to set the column's title,type,sortable options dynamically. Create the Grid columns by using the names of the fields returned in the server response. When binding the Grid to local data (local array of objects), we have to somehow postpone the binding of the data until the widget is recreated. @pedy711 Why do I get two different answers for the current through the 47 k resistor when I do a source transformation? I don't think anyone finds what I'm working on interesting. Read about initial: inherit The problem is I want to reset this grid after post to flush it and insert another value I try to use the next commands: but none of them flush my kendo after post, what can be the problem there? This jsfiddle - Kendo UI grid dynamic columns can help you - using kendo.observable. How can I remove a style added with .css() function? It would be really great if you could create a sample project using https://stackblitz.com/ as a showcase.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Question: Find centralized, trusted content and collaborate around the technologies you use most. Create the dataSource.model by using the first record in the response as a sample. MATLAB command "fourier"only applicable for continous time signals or is it also applicable for discrete time signals? var newDataSource = new kendo.data.DataSource({data: dataSource}); $("#grid").data("kendoGrid").setDataSource(newDataSource); Sign in Use the special k-rebind attribute to create a widget which automatically updates when some scope variable changes. Supported file types: PNG, JPG, JPEG, ZIP, RAR, TXT. Welcome to Stack Overflow! https://fancygrid.com/api/methods, But it is very simple case, usually for working with server it requires to config data.proxy. In that case, you would need to first force the info array to be refreshed(by doing whatever you did to fill it the first time again) THEN update the grid's dataSource with the new data, THEN rebind the grid. Code-only answers are generally discouraged. The method .data() was what I was looking for. do not set any column settings). Why is proving something is NP-complete useful, and where can I use it? After doing zoom screen column is getting hide, I want to do wrap column. What worked for me (maybe there is a cleaner solution to this) is to use the $timeout service: This has been tested using AngularJS v1.5.0 and Kendo UI v2016.1.226. To learn more, see our tips on writing great answers. Is it possible to group kendo grid columns with two column names? I prefer women who cook good food, who speak three languages, and who go mountain hiking - what if it is a woman who only has one of the attributes? How can I upload files asynchronously with jQuery? Should we burninate the [variations] tag? Also needs to know more about data structure. How can a GPS receiver estimate position faster than the worst case 12.5 min it takes to get ionospheric model parameters? How can a GPS receiver estimate position faster than the worst case 12.5 min it takes to get ionospheric model parameters? This is what I used to change the number of columns dynamically for local js data. Solution. In the MultiSelect change event handler, get the current . Well occasionally send you account related emails. After doing zoom screen column is getting hide, I want to do wrap column. How to get selected page number in kendo grid. Kendo UI Angular - How do I Wrap Header Columns? An inf-sup estimate for holomorphic functions. The text was updated successfully, but these errors were encountered: Good day @pedy711, Max total file size - 20MB. Connect and share knowledge within a single location that is structured and easy to search.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. In a kendo grid, can I set column attributes dynamically with a function?, Reset Kendo Grid column, How to make Kendo Grid Column auto Width, How to wrap Kendo Grid Column. Connect and share knowledge within a single location that is structured and easy to search. All Telerik .NET tools and Kendo UI JavaScript components in one package. Another option could be to use the setOptions () method with a custom UI, for example a Kendo UI MultiSelect that holds a collection of all the available columns. I'd like to use a function to return attributes if that is supported. Already on GitHub? Why are only 2 out of the 3 boosters on Falcon Heavy reused? Could you please provide us with a sample that works with the remote data? The reason is that new columns can be added to table at a later stage and that also needs to be displayed on the grid. In a kendo grid, can I set column attributes dynamically with a function?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Kendo Grid( JQuery) with custom paging and dynamic columns, Kendo Grid edit cell from button inside the cell. Typescript error using new apollo server version in nestjs application, Rotate icon 180 degree with animation in flutter, Laravel validation: require any of two field if another field is available, MySQL Query the most recent 10 records per different ID, Ionic 5 Ion-Slider Bound Options Not Affecting the Component. Solution. Kendo ui context menu is not working when Kendo ui editor id target, Css mouseover and mouseout in javascript examples, Dart dart return future value code example, Shell combine two repositories git code example, Import bootstrap in angular json code example, Angular service singleton constructor called multiple times, Python create df from groupby code example, Css woocommerce product gallery slider code example.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. kendo grid columns is given as below. Which is the best, most efficient method of concatenation? I used jQuery plugin datatables, which will auto width columns to fetch the title or data content length if we don't specify the column width of the Grid. How can I change an element's class with JavaScript? The refresh method will render your grid again, that means your functions weather is a template or an attribute function ( and again, that does not work at all for me) will run and apply the correct sytles, or classes in this case. Leading a two people project, I feel like the other person isn't pulling their weight or is actively silently quitting or obstructing it. Stack Overflow for Teams is moving to its own domain! You said you don't want to use templates, but I think you were talking about column templates. in the updated kendo version they have their implementations nowadays.. but glad it helped, Wow, that's a bizarre behavior that Telerik implemented. I've got some code here where I am trying to set a background color of a cell based on the value of the data item: http://dojo.telerik.com/@solidus-flux/eHaMu. If you need to set data dynamically in grid then you need What is the best way to show results of a multiple-choice quiz where multiple options may be right? Also, do not. Thank you for provided information.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. Downvote because this is not "change columns dinamically". Grant custom permissions to user in mysql, Sqlite3.ProgrammingError: Incorrect number of bindings supplied. we can remove all the data in the grid by using a single statement. Making statements based on opinion; back them up with references or personal experience. Do US public school students have a First Amendment right to be able to perform sacred music? Finding features that intersect QgsRectangle but are not equal to themselves using PyQGIS, Leading a two people project, I feel like the other person isn't pulling their weight or is actively silently quitting or obstructing it, Fourier transform of a functional derivative. Refreshing grid just after changing columns makes it to reload items include the new column without doing any extra actions in the grid like grouping. Could you try to replicate problem on that sample, please? Take a look at this DOC Why does KendoUI grid add a row to the beginning of the grid and not give the User a choice using rowindex? This is changing the column collection but not reflecting immediately in my grid. I've got some code here where I am trying to set a background color of a cell based on the value of the data item: http://dojo.telerik.com/@solidus-flux/eHaMu. How to set kendo grid horizontal scrollbar Only? Would it be illegal for me to act as a Civillian Traffic Enforcer? GridColumnGeneration.push ( { title: GridTitleArray [i], field: GridTitleArray [i . In provided sample, columns are set on start. https://stackblitz.com/edit/angular-fms2ox, https://fancygrid.com/api/methods/setdata, https://fancygrid.com/api/config/data/proxy, https://fancygrid.com/api/methods/setcolumns. Not the answer you're looking for? I actually would like to see how do you configure the columns once you get the data from the server. There I add fields for post action. public List<string> ColumnList { get; set; } public List<List<string>> ColumnValues { get; set; } } ColumnList contains the title of column headers. Hi, I am binding dynamic data to kendo ui grid without defining schema. Not the answer you're looking for? $("#grid").data("kendoGrid").dataSource.read(); After fighting this for a day and seeing hints in this thread that Kendo had simplified this problem, I discovered you can just use setOptions with a single property. I tried the following code but it didn't show the grid. http://dojo.telerik.com/@solidus-flux/eHaMu,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. Can we do it by giving some propery on gridColumns. Kendogrid destroy() and recreate the table on a new datasource, why do the old table columns still exist? Worked like a charm, with a few improvisations for my scenario. I am trying to change the columns collection of my Kendo grid in the below way. TopITAnswers. Something like this: Correct handling of negative chapter numbers. How to change the order of a group using Kendo grid? Now I want the same function in kendo Grid, however, I cannot find it except make Grid wrapper style fixed and set a col width css for all columns, which make the small length field also take big space. How to manually set column value in kendo grid? It works when I inject your code, as explained, in the constructor because gridConfig becomes available to the html tag immediately, but when it is sort of lazy loaded then it throws that error. Could not call _thead() method, since this is messing with internal code from the library it may break in version updates, How to change columns set of kendo grid dynamically,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. but what are the changes i made in databound event are not reflecting to the grid. Does the Fog Cloud spell work in conjunction with the Blind Fighting fighting style the way I think it does? grid.refresh() will only rebind the grid to the current dataSourceit does not force the underlying dataSource to re-read from the server. Gets or sets the table rows (or cells) which are selected. Working demo with fake data: http://dojo.telerik.com/@Stephen/aGAQo Based on the id value of the Model, conditionally determine an editable column. How to set Kendo UI grid column widths programmatically, Kendo Grid Custom Flter Set Filter Value Programmatically, KendoGrid - Filtering on a property of object. you saved me a day, I tried it and it does not work. How can I merge properties of two JavaScript objects dynamically? grid.columns option in databound event. Read about length units: Demo initial: Sets this property to its default value. 2022 Moderator Election Q&A Question Collection. Further documentation can be found in the Telerik's official forum Header Wrapping / Height and How to wrap kendo grid column. Our use case requires that we feed the grid with columns names and data which come from the server. at FancyGridComponent.push../node_modules/fancy-grid-angular/fesm5/fancy-grid-angular.js.FancyGridComponent.ngAfterViewInit. thank you. i tried to fetch the columns using. Instead of looping through all the elements. https://stackblitz.com/edit/angular-fms2ox. Progress is the leading provider of application development and digital experience technologies. CxGS, FgElzH, RnA, vGGCl, XXcFat, QCwv, IhIAjN, DYZ, fMiol, BohVO, EeWrZx, URwTjy, NaEuY, MjT, ngSe, ECl, hMl, BNJ, ermw, wzxRa, SisL, BxTJ, YycKbc, VNVm, cInb, dLEP, VOH, rTgzGW, AvxxUF, Paaa, lsaJ, huHp, POMNK, rlU, HAwRoe, OoIh, CPQ, pzXF, qAGVOZ, bXdWaI, ZvrAa, DWeyS, hyDr, FoiFC, sAdC, ysZ, YTq, KqJcrv, voIL, Kwz, oxNbR, CNyaGW, kfGrL, sauu, CAbql, HFf, Sqv, Sfycsq, NltT, dRmEJ, evL, oumIR, HzxVj, BVPVV, vftw, ERQnez, oBAsR, qCJVm, OcVRw, tqJkM, MIb, DwsW, QWAoS, yFaXNO, qrHbW, rtwoN, YQqaF, MEi, LPk, JBnJb, DijeRc, RWZn, GEiQL, MLkwOk, yWT, XmgGD, RkRpXr, vKnHaz, SDsO, BNryy, esykKB, HPlKir, hiYt, bWF, WEo, NXvvYA, dZrba, QAmY, xaV, ijkG, FGhO, TWCP, kaZStT, REeOEj, TDG, BNknP, Auo, Vsjk, RNU, YaeK,

A Soft Moist Part Of A Fruit Crossword Clue, Alesso Electric Zoo 2021 Tracklist, How To Op Yourself In Minehut New Update, Css Donut Chart Animation, Blackberry Milkshake Ipa Recipe, Give In Eventually Crossword Clue, Postman Multipart/form-data Content-type,

kendo grid columns set attributes dynamically